A Look Into into the Effects and Risks of 3-MMC Powder
3-MMC powder, a synthetic stimulant with questionable effects, has risen in popularity in recent years. Its chemical structure closely resembles that of other well-known stimulants like amphetamine, leading to analogous effects. Users report feelings of excitement, increased concentration, and a sense of well-being. However, the dangerous side effects associated with 3-MMC powder are serious. These can range from typical symptoms like anxiety, insomnia, and increased heart rate to more intense issues such as seizures, psychosis, and even here death. The uncontrolled nature surrounding 3-MMC powder further complicates its potential for harm.

Decoding the Effects : Understanding 3-MMC's Chemistry
Diving into the complexities of 3-MMC requires a look at its underlying chemistry. This manufactured stimulant, often categorized as a cathinone analog, exerts its effects by interacting with neural pathways. Specifically, 3-MMC is known to boost the release of dopamine, a chemical messenger associated with pleasure.
The structure of 3-MMC plays a vital role in its pharmacological properties. Its molecular arrangement allows it to replicate the effects of natural cathinones, like those found in cathinone plants. This parallelism contributes to its ability to induce feelings of elation, energy, and focus.
